Be Verbs (am, is, are) Simple Present

2

media

Point 1: The Be verb has three forms in the present tense: am, is, are. It connects a subject with a noun, adjective, or preposition.

  1. I am American.

  2. I am not tired.

  3. I'm happy. (am = 'm)

  4. I'm not sad. (am = 'm)

Point 2: Use am and am not for the pronoun I.

6

media
  1. You are a student.

  2. You are not a teacher.

  3. You're a nice person. (are = 're)

  4. You're not late. (are not = 're not)

  5. You aren't late. (are not = aren't)

Point 3: Use are and are not for the pronoun you.

7

media
media
media

​Mary is my friend.

She is not my sister.

She's very smart. (is = 's)

She's not here. (is not = 's not)

She isn't here. (is not = isn't)

​​Point 4: Use is and is not for the pronoun she.

Jason is my friend.

He is not my brother.

He's very smart. (is = 's)

He's not here. (is not = 's not)

He isn't here. (is not = isn't)

Point 5: Use is and is not for the pronoun he.

​The weather is cold today.

It is not warm.

It's easy. (is = 's)

It's not hard (is not = 's not)

It isn't hard. (is not = isn't)

Point 6: Use is and is not for the pronoun it.

8

media
media
  1. ​Beth and Bob are my friends.

  2. They are not from here.

  3. They're nice people.(are = 're)

  4. They're not shy. (are not = 're not)

  5. They aren't shy. (are not = aren't)

​​Point 7: Use are and are not for the pronoun they.

  1. ​My friend and I are here.

  2. We are not late.

  3. We're good friends. (are = 're)

  4. We're not busy. (are not = 're not)

  5. We aren't busy. (are not = aren't)

​​Point 8: Use are and are not for the pronoun we.

9

Point 9: For question words, the verb matches the subject.

  1. ​What is your favorite food?

  2. When is the meeting?

  3. Who are your teachers?

  4. Where are the bathrooms?

  5. Why is it cold in here?

  6. How are you?

​BRILLIANT!

10

Point 9: For question words, the verb matches the subject.

  1. How is school?

  2. How are your classes?

  3. Why am I here?

  4. Why is she late?

  5. Why isn't she here?

  6. Why aren't you mad?
